LUCAS, Ky. – If the cold winter weather really makes you hungry, visit the Driftwood Restaurant at Barren River Lake State Resort Park to satisfy your appetite with some comfort food.
Travel
back in time with a taste of the past during Buffalo Night on Feb. 4.
Enjoy a variety of buffalo dishes prepared by the park’s chef.
Take a culinary “tour of America” without ever leaving Kentucky. Visit
the park on the following dates to let your taste buds experience some
of our great American cultures: Miami Cuban cuisine – Feb. 2; New
Orleans Creole and Cajun foods – Feb. 16; American Indian foods from
across the Plains - March 1; and traditional American foods of Boston -
March 22.
The
park is surrounded by rolling, tree-covered hills, on the edge of a
beautiful 10,000-acre lake. It has 51 lodge rooms, 22 cottages, and 99
campsites for you to stay at the park. Enjoy the relaxing atmosphere of
an upscale fish camp in the Driftwood Restaurant. If you are looking for
something to do during your visit, you can play on the 18-hole golf
course, hike along a nature trail, visit the marina to rent a boat,
check out a fishing pole or sports equipment, browse the gift shop, or
just enjoy a peaceful seat overlooking the lake.
The resort is 44 miles southeast of Bowling Green. Take I-65 to the Cumberland Parkway east, to US 31E south. Call 1-800-325-0057 for information.
